Transaction 40532a115ac84952c93c1d0275e5b334cac9d089385eff58e27e645939a49877

1 Input
2 Outputs
  • 40532a115ac84952c93c1d0275e5b334cac9d089385eff58e27e645939a49877:0
  • value  28281
    address  bc1q8ge29n2x7veqwy5nca0uz54kaefwc4wsml8p5g
  • 40532a115ac84952c93c1d0275e5b334cac9d089385eff58e27e645939a49877:1
  • value  504295
    address  1keywbKududyFYr71uqro52bHcTCqX9Kv